如何检测服务器有几个cpu

fiy 其他 29

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器的CPU信息可以通过多种方式来检测,下面列举了几种常见的方法。

    1. 命令行方式:
      使用命令行工具可以方便快捷地获取服务器的CPU信息。在Windows系统下,可以使用如下命令:
      systeminfo | findstr /C:"Processor(s)"
      运行命令后,会输出处理器的数量以及其他相关信息。
      在Linux系统下,可以使用如下命令:
      lscpu
      运行命令后,会输出详细的处理器信息,包括逻辑核心数量、物理核心数量等。

    2. 系统信息工具:
      服务器操作系统通常提供了系统信息工具,可以查看硬件配置信息,其中包括CPU的数量。在Windows系统中,可以通过打开“系统信息”工具来查看CPU信息。在Linux系统中,可以使用工具如lshw、hardinfo等来获取硬件信息,其中包括CPU信息。

    3. 第三方工具:
      除了系统自带的工具外,还可以使用第三方的服务器管理工具来获取CPU信息。这些工具通常提供更为详细的硬件信息和管理功能,可以通过图形界面或命令行来操作。例如,Windows系统下有CPU-Z、HWiNFO等工具;Linux系统下有dmidecode、hwinfo等工具。

    总之,通过命令行方式、系统信息工具或第三方工具,我们可以轻松地获取服务器的CPU信息,包括数量、型号、频率等。选择合适的方法,根据自己的需要获取相关信息即可。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要确定服务器有多少个CPU,可以使用以下几种方法:

    1. 查看服务器的物理配置信息:登录到服务器,运行以下命令之一,可以查看系统的物理处理器信息:

      • cat /proc/cpuinfo:此命令将显示每个核心的详细信息,包括物理处理器的数量、核心数量、型号等。
      • lscpu:此命令将显示与CPU相关的详细信息,包括处理器数量、套接字数量、核心数量等。

      通过查看这些信息,您可以确定服务器上有多少个物理处理器。

    2. 使用命令行工具来检测CPU数量:有一些命令行工具可以提供更简洁的输出来查看CPU数量。以下是一些常用的命令行工具:

      • nproc:此命令将返回可用的物理处理器数量。
      • lscpu:此命令将返回更详细的CPU信息,包括物理处理器数量、套接字数量、核心数量等。

      运行这些命令,您将能够快速获取服务器上的CPU数量。

    3. 使用图形界面工具来检测CPU数量:除了命令行工具外,还有一些图形界面工具可以提供可视化界面来查看服务器的CPU数量。

      • htop:这是一款功能强大的进程监视器,可以实时显示服务器资源的使用情况,包括CPU数量。
      • System Monitor:这是一个用于查看服务器状态和资源使用情况的图形界面工具,它可以显示CPU数量和其他系统信息。

      运行这些工具,您可以通过点击相关选项或标签来查看CPU数量。

    4. 查看服务器的规格或说明书:如果您无法直接访问服务器,您可以查看服务器的规格或说明书,通常可以在制造商的网站上找到。这些文件通常包含服务器的详细信息,包括CPU数量。

    5. 使用远程管理工具:如果您无法直接访问服务器,但有远程管理工具的访问权限,可以使用这些工具来查看服务器的物理配置信息。根据您所使用的远程管理工具,您可以在工具的界面中找到服务器的详细信息,包括CPU数量。

    通过以上方法,您将能够准确地确定服务器上有多少个CPU。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要检测服务器有几个CPU,可以使用多种方法和工具。下面将介绍两种常用的方法:通过操作系统命令和使用第三方工具。

    方法一:通过操作系统命令

    1. Linux系统:

      在Linux系统中,可以使用以下命令来检测服务器有几个CPU:

      cat /proc/cpuinfo | grep "physical id" | sort -u | wc -l
      

      该命令会读取 /proc/cpuinfo 文件,然后使用 grep 过滤出包含 "physical id" 字段的行,再使用 sort -u 去重,最后使用 wc -l 统计行数。这个数字就代表了服务器上实际的物理CPU数量。

    2. Windows系统:

      在Windows系统中,可以使用以下命令来检测服务器有几个CPU:

      wmic cpu get DeviceID,NumberOfCores,NumberOfLogicalProcessors /format:list
      

      该命令会使用 wmic 命令行工具来获取CPU信息,并显示出每个CPU的设备ID、核心数和逻辑处理器数。可以根据输出的结果统计实际的物理CPU数量。

    方法二:使用第三方工具

    除了操作系统自带的命令外,还有一些第三方工具可以帮助检测服务器的CPU数量。

    1. CPU-Z:

      CPU-Z 是一个广泛使用的系统信息和硬件监测工具,可以在 Windows 和 Linux 平台上运行。它可以显示处理器、主板、内存和图形处理器等硬件信息,并提供了详细的规格和性能参数。通过 CPU-Z,可以直接查看服务器的 CPU 信息,包括数量、型号、核心数和线程数等。

    2. HWiNFO:

      HWiNFO 是另一个功能强大的系统信息和硬件监测工具,可以在 Windows 平台上运行。与 CPU-Z 类似,它可以提供详细的硬件信息,并具有图形化界面。通过 HWiNFO,可以方便地查看服务器的 CPU 信息,包括数量、型号、核心数和线程数等。

    综上所述,我们可以通过操作系统命令或使用第三方工具来检测服务器有几个CPU。无论使用哪种方法,都可以很方便地获取到服务器的CPU信息。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部